Common Pricing Structures



Recognizing exactly how drywall pricing is structured can help you budget plan properly for your task. Many drywall contractors charge based upon the square footage of the location to be covered. You'll typically locate prices ranging from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ot, depending upon variables like worldly top quality and labor proficiency.



Some specialists might also provide a per-sheet price, which usually drops in between $10 and $15 per drywall sheet (4x8 feet). If a knockout post working with a bigger project, you might find that service providers are open to negotiating bulk discount rates.

In addition to standard prices, watch out for rates variants based on the project's intricacy. For example, if your walls call for complex styles or you require to install drywall in hard-to-reach areas, expect to pay a premium.

It's additionally worth considering whether the quote consists of completing, such as taping, mudding, and sanding, as this can dramatically influence the general expense.

Extra Providers and Charges



Typically, drywall jobs come with additional services and fees that can impact your overall budget. To keep your costs in check, it's vital to recognize what these extras could include. For example, lots of contractors charge for solutions like drywall delivery, which can include in your expenditures if you're not prepared.

You could also run into expenses for completing services, such as taping, mudding, and sanding. These are crucial for accomplishing a smooth surface area yet can dramatically enhance the final expense.

In addition, if your job calls for special materials - like moisture-resistant or soundproof drywall - await greater costs.

An additional possible fee comes from cleaning and disposal. Some professionals may include this in their initial quote, while others may bill an added charge at the end. It's finest to clarify this upfront.

Last but not least, if you need repair work or modifications to existing frameworks, like framing or insulation, these solutions will also include in your overall expenses. Always request a thorough quote that lays out any potential additional solutions and fees to prevent shocks down the line. Openness is vital to remaining within your budget.
